Khamariya Patera Population - Damoh, Madhya Pradesh

Khamariya Patera is a medium size village located in Patera Tehsil of Damoh district, Madhya Pradesh with total 89 families residing. The Khamariya Patera village has population of 328 of which 175 are males while 153 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Khamariya Patera village population of children with age 0-6 is 53 which makes up 16.16 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Khamariya Patera village is 874 which is lower than Madhya Pradesh state average of 931. Child Sex Ratio for the Khamariya Patera as per census is 710, lower than Madhya Pradesh average of 918.

Khamariya Patera village has lower literacy rate compared to Madhya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Khamariya Patera village was 66.18 % compared to 69.32 % of Madhya Pradesh. In Khamariya Patera Male literacy stands at 82.64 % while female literacy rate was 48.09 %.

Caste Factor

There is no population of Schedule Caste (SC) and Schedule Tribe(ST) in Khamariya Patera village of Damoh district.

Work Profile

In Khamariya Patera village out of total population, 98 were engaged in work activities. 42.86 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 57.14 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 98 workers engaged in Main Work, 34 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 1 were Agricultural labourer.
